Win or die trying top The Madcows for fourth straight win, 197.06-163.37

Win or die trying extended their win streak to four games with a hard-fought win over The Madcows, earning a 197.06-163.37 victory. Win or die trying never trailed in this one after earning a 31.21-point lead on Thursday behind Deonte Harris (20.75 points) and the New Orleans Saints defense (10.46). Matthew Stafford (295 Pass Yds, 3 Pass TDs) and Diontae Johnson (8 Rec, 105 Rec Yds, 2 Rec TDs) were the leaders for The Madcows in the loss. Win or die trying improve to 9-4 on the season, while The Madcows fall to 11-2.

Matchup Player of the Week

Against the Seahawks in Week 13, Kittle scored 37.1 points to more-than-triple his 10.27-point projection. He caught 9 passes for 181 yards and 2 touchdowns to beat his projection by the third-highest percentage of any TE in the league this season. Next week, Kittle will play the Bengals.
